About the AMD Radeon VII GPU

The Radeon VII is a desktop graphics card by AMD. It launched in Q1 2019 with a suggested retail price of $699. Its Vega 20 chip that powers the GPU uses the GCN 5.1 architecture and is fabricated on the 7 nm process.

This GPU is paired with 16 GB of HBM2 VRAM. Its 1,000 MHz memory clock and 4,096 bit interface gives it a bandwidth of 1.02 Tb/s. This impacts how much data it can store, and how fast it transfers the data to and from memory.

The VII is a dual slot graphics card, taking up 2 PCIe slots. It supports HDMI 2.0b, DisplayPort 1.4a display ports. This desktop card has a TDP of 295 W. AMD recommends using a power supply of at least 600 W with this card. A power supply lower than this might result in system crashes and potentially damage your hardware.

The Radeon VII has the 45th highest 3DMark 11 Performance GPU score among the 540 benchmarked GPUs in our database. It achieves 36.10% of the performance of the best benchmarked GPU, the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4090. Its 37,881 score and $699 launch price (MSRP) gives it a performance per dollar of 54.19. This is the 60th best in value for the 3DMark 11 Performance GPU benchmark.

About the AMD Radeon RX Vega 64 GPU

The Radeon RX Vega 64 is a desktop graphics card by AMD. It launched in Q3 2017 with a suggested retail price of $499. Its Vega 10 chip that powers the GPU uses the GCN 5.0 architecture and is fabricated on the 14 nm process.

This GPU is paired with 8 GB of HBM2 VRAM. Its 945 MHz memory clock and 2,048 bit interface gives it a bandwidth of 483.8 Gb/s. This impacts how much data it can store, and how fast it transfers the data to and from memory.

The RX Vega 64 is a dual slot graphics card, taking up 2 PCIe slots. It supports HDMI 2.0b, DisplayPort 1.4a display ports. This desktop card has a TDP of 295 W. AMD recommends using a power supply of at least 600 W with this card. A power supply lower than this might result in system crashes and potentially damage your hardware.

The Radeon RX Vega 64 has the 72nd highest 3DMark 11 Performance GPU score among the 540 benchmarked GPUs in our database. It achieves 29.37% of the performance of the best benchmarked GPU, the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4090. Its 30,823.5 score and $499 launch price (MSRP) gives it a performance per dollar of 61.77. This is the 52nd best in value for the 3DMark 11 Performance GPU benchmark.
